Unlocking Wireless Potential: Wi-Fi Performance
The Wi-Fi component of the EDUP 8568 provides wireless internet connectivity at speeds up to 150Mbps. This speed is indicative of the 802.11n standard, which operates primarily on the 2.4GHz frequency band. For many users, 150Mbps is sufficient.
This level of bandwidth is perfectly adequate for everyday internet tasks. Users can comfortably browse websites, check emails, stream standard definition (SD) video, and participate in video calls without significant lag. It handles basic online activities with ease. This capability transforms a wired-only desktop into a flexible wireless workstation, or upgrades an older laptop's slower Wi-Fi standard.
Compared to integrated 802.11g or even older 802.11b Wi-Fi cards, the 150Mbps 802.11n standard represents a noticeable improvement in both speed and range. While not designed for multi-gigabit fiber connections or demanding 4K streaming, it provides a stable and reliable connection for general use. This is a solid step up.
Seamless Peripheral Integration: Bluetooth Capabilities
Beyond Wi-Fi, the EDUP 8568 incorporates Bluetooth 4.0 connectivity. Bluetooth 4.0, also known as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E), brought significant advancements in power efficiency while maintaining robust data transfer for short-range wireless communication. It's energy efficient.
This allows users to connect a multitude of wireless peripherals to their computer. Think wireless mice, keyboards, headphones, speakers, and even game controllers. The ability to connect up to seven Bluetooth-enabled devices simultaneously within a range of approximately 32.8 feet (10 meters) significantly reduces cable clutter and enhances desktop ergonomics. Peripherals connect effortlessly. This feature is particularly valuable for desktops that typically lack built-in Bluetooth, or for laptops with older, less reliable Bluetooth versions.
In contrast to older Bluetooth standards (like 2.0 or 3.0), Bluetooth 4.0 offers improved stability and reduced power consumption, especially beneficial for battery-powered devices. While newer Bluetooth 5.0+ versions offer greater range and speed, Bluetooth 4.0 remains a highly functional and widely supported standard for most common wireless accessories. It still serves its purpose well.

Beyond Client Mode: Soft AP Functionality
A notable feature of the EDUP 8568 is its Soft AP mode capability. This function allows the adapter to transform a computer with an existing internet connection into a Wi-Fi hotspot. The computer becomes a router.
This is incredibly useful in scenarios where a dedicated router is unavailable, or when a wired internet connection needs to be shared wirelessly with other devices. Imagine a hotel room with only an Ethernet port; the adapter can turn a laptop into a personal Wi-Fi network for a phone or tablet. It creates a local network. This capability extends the utility of the adapter beyond just receiving Wi-Fi, enabling it to act as a wireless access point for other devices to connect to the internet. It shares connectivity effectively.
This distinguishes the EDUP 8568 from many basic Wi-Fi dongles that only function as clients. The Soft AP mode adds a layer of versatility, making the adapter a more comprehensive
networking tool, particularly for travelers or those in temporary setups. It offers more options.
Broad System Compatibility
The adapter boasts broad compatibility with various operating systems. It supports Windows 10, 8.1, 7, and XP, alongside macOS versions from OS X 10.6 up to 10.15.3. This ensures wide usability.
This extensive support means that users with older systems, which might struggle with drivers for newer hardware, can still benefit from this upgrade. Whether it's an aging desktop running Windows 7 or a MacBook from a few years back, the adapter should integrate smoothly. It works with many platforms. This broad compatibility minimizes the risk of purchasing an adapter that won't function with an existing system, providing peace of mind for users looking to extend the life of their current hardware.
